Ajax Downs Opens 50th Season On Sunday, May 5
The 50th anniversary of Quarter Horse Racing at Ajax Downs kicks off Sunday, May 5, the first of 25 exciting racing days and special events to celebrate half a century of the popular sport.
 
What started as friendly match races between horses and their owners became an organized sport in 1969 at Picov Downs, named for one of its founders, Alex Picov. The sport grew under the Picov family and today, Quarter Horse racing is held at the state of the art, five-furlong Ajax Downs, where Sunday afternoons at the races are the best days of the summer.
 
All of our popular event days are back including Mother's Day, Craft Beer Day, Family Day and more, plus a special 50th Anniversary afternoon on July 14 complete with Wiener Dog Races.
 
Top riders Brian Bell, Cory Spataro, Tony Phillips and Ramiro Castillo are back, plus many of the Champion horses from recent years including 3-time Horse of the Year Country Boy 123.
